Terms
lists of medical terms
Question | Answer |
---|---|
Adomin(o) | - root word - abdomen |
Aden(o) | - root word - gland |
Adren(o) | - root word - adrenal gland |
Alveoi(o) | - root word - air sac |
angi(o) | - root word - vessel |
arteri(o) | - root word - artery |
ather(o) | - root word - fatty degeneration |
arthr(o) | - root word - joint |
audi(o) | - root word - hearing |
bio | - root word -life |
Bronch(i)/bronch(o) | - root word - bronchus |
carcin(o) | - root word - cancer |
cardi(o) | - root word - heart |
cellul(o)/cyt(o) | - root word - cell |
cerebell(o) | - root word - cerebellum |
Cerebr(i)/Cerebr(o) | - root word -Cerebrum |
chol(e) | - root word -bile |
cholecyst(o) | - root word - gall bladder |
chondr(i))/chondr(o) | -root word -cartilage |
col(o) | - root word - colon |
cost(o) | - root word - rib |
cry(o) | - root word - cold |
cutane(o) | - root word - skin |
cyan(o) | - root word - blue |
cyst(o) | - root word - bladder |
dipl(o) | - root word - double |
duoden(o) | - root word - duodenum |
encephal(o) | -root word - brain |
enter(o) | - root word - intestine |
esophag(o) | - root word - esophagus |
erythr(o | - root word - red |
fibr(o) | - root word - fibers |
Gastr(o) | - root word - stomach |
hemat(o)/hem(o) | - root word - blood |
heter(o) | - root word - other or different |
Hidr(o) | - root word - sweat |
hist(o) | - root word - tissue |
hom(o) | - root word -same or alike |
hydr(o) | - root word - water |
hyster(o) | - root word - uterus or womb |
latr(o) | - root word - treatement |
laryng(o) | - root word - larynx |
leuk(o) | - root word -white |
lith(o) | - root word - stone |
lipid(o) | - root word - fat |
lymph(o) | - root word - lymph vessel |
melan(o) | - root word - black |
mening(o) | -root word - meninges |
Men(o) | - root word - menses or menstration |
myel(o) | - root word - bone marrow of spinal cord |
my(o) | - root word -muscle |
nat(o) | - root word - birth or new |
necr(o) | - root word - death |
nephr(o) | - root word - kidney |
neur(o) | - root word - nerve |
oss(eo)/oss(i)/ost(e)/ost(eo) | - root word - bone |
path(o) | - root word - disease |
peritone(o) | - root word - peritoneum |
pharmac(o) | - root word - drug |
pharyng(o) | - root word - pharynx |
phleb(o) | - root word - vein |
phren(o) | - root word - diaphragm |
pneumon(a)/pneumon(o)/pulmon(o) | - root word - lungs |
rect(o) | - root word - rectum |
ren(o) | - root word - kidney |
sacr(o) | - root word - sarcum |
scapul(o) | - root word - scapula |
sept(o) | - root word - infection |
splen(o) | - root word - spleen |
spondyl(o) | - root word -vertebra |
stern(o) | - root word - sternum |
tend(o)/ten(o) | - root word - tendon |
testicul(o) | - root word - testis |
therm(o) | - root word - heat |
thorac(o) | - root word - chest |
Ur(i/o/a) | - root word - urine |
urethr(o) | - root word - urthra |
ureter(o) | - root word - ureter |
Vas(o)/Ven(o) | - root word - vein |
viscer(o) | - root word - viscera |
xanth(o) | - root word - yellow |
xer(o) | - root word - dry |
-ac | - suffix - pertaning to |
-ic | - suffix - pertaining to |
-al | - suffix - pertaining to |
-ous | - suffix - pertaining to |
-tic | - suffix - pertaining to |
-algia | -suffix - pain |
-dynia | - suffix - pain |
-ate | - suffix - to use |
-ize | - suffix - to use |
-cele | - suffix - protrusion |
-centesis | - suffix - surgical puncture or withdraw fluid |
-cle | - suffix -small |
-cule | - suffix - small |
-ule | - suffix -small |
-ulus | - suffix -small |
-cyte | - suffix - cell |
-desis | - suffix - surgical binding |
-ectomy | - suffix - cutting out |
-emesis | - suffix - to vomit |
-emia | - suffix - pertaining to the blood |
-esis | -suffix - condition of |
- ia | - suffix -condition of |
-iasis | -suffix -condition of |
-ity | - suffix -condition of |
-osis | - suffix - condition of |
-tion | - suffix - condition of |
-y | -suffix -condition of |
-form | -suffix -to resemble |
- oid | -suffix - to resemble |
-genesis | - suffix - to form/make |
-gram | - suffix - a written record |
-graph | - suffix - process of recording |
-ism | - suffix - theory |
-itis | - suffix - inflammation |
-lysis | - suffix -break down or destruction |
- malacia | - suffix - softening |
-megaly | - suffix - enlargement |
-meter | - suffix - instrument used to measure |
-ologist | - suffix - specialist |
-logy | -suffix -the study of a specific field |
-opsy | - suffix - to view |
-otomy | - suffix - cutting into |
-ostomy | - suffix - artificial or surgical opening |
-stomy | - suffix - artificial or surgical opening |
-pathy | - suffix - disease state |
- penia | - suffix -lack or deficient |
-pexy | - suffix - surgical fixation |
- pexis | - suffix - surgical fixation |
-phagia | - suffix - to swallow |
- phobia | - suffix - fear of |
- plasia | - suffix - formation |
-plasty | - suffix - reconstruction or shaping |
-plegia | -suffix -paralysis |
-pnea | - suffix - breathing |
-ptosis | -suffix -drooping |
-rrhage | -suffix -excessive flow or discharge |
-rrhaphy | - suffix - to suture or fixate |
-rrhea | - suffix - flow or discharge |
-sclerosis | - suffix - hardening |
-scope | - suffix - instrument used to examine |
- spasm | - suffix - involuntary movement |
-trophic | -suffix -growth of developement |
-trophy | -suffix -growth or developement |
A- | - Prefix - lack of or without |
An- | - prefix -lack of or without |
Ab | -prefix - away from |
Ad | - prefix - towards or near |
anti | - prefix - opposing or against |
auto | - prefix - self |
bi | - prefix - double |
brady | - prefix - slow |
brachy | - prefix - short |
circum | - prefix - around |
co | -prefix - together or with |
con | - prefix - together or with |
contra | - prefix - against |
di | - prefix - twice |
dia | - prefix - through, between |
dis | - prefix - apart from of free from |
dys | - prefix - bad or difficult |
ect | -prefix - outer |
exo | - prefix -outer |
ecto | - prefix - outer |
endo | -prefix - within |
epi | - prefix -above, outer, or over |
extra | -prefix -beyond or outside of |
hemi | - prefix - half |
hyper | -prefix -execessive |
hypo | - prefix -below or deficient |
infra | -prefix - beneath |
inter | - prefix - between |
intra | - prefix -within or inside |
marco | - prefix -large |
mal | - prefix - bad |
mes | - prefix - middle |
meta | - prefix -changing |
micro | - prefix - small |
mono | -prefix -one |
multi | - prefix - many |
neo | - prefix - new or recent |
oligo | - prefix - scanty |
pan | - prefix -all |
para | - prefix - beside |
peri | - prefix - around |
poly | - prefix - many |
post | - prefix - after or following |
pre | - prefix - before or preceding |
presby | - prefix - old age |
pseudo | - prefix - false |
quadric | - prefix -four |
retro | - prefix - backward |
sub | - prefix - under or beneath |
supra | - prefix - above |
tachy | - prefix - rapid or fast |
tri | - prefix - three |
